Fixed by Produce.
Every letters in this font family has a fix width. It has a softer take on the typical monospace fonts. The constraint has create an interesting and playful look on letters especially the extra long ones.

Tepu by Latinotype.
Tepu is a pictogram set which is inspired in modern iconography. It is a font with three different versions. Black: white icons on a black background, Regular: black icons on a white background, and Outline: pictograms made with constant thickness.
Tepu is a typeface best suited for information design, maps, user interface, instructions and educational purposes. Each set contains 369 icons.

Voltage by Laura Worthington.
Like many of Worthington’s typefaces, Voltage is evocative of a milieu or era. Here, we see the metal lettering on automobiles of the past—with their retro takes on a bright future–and those emblems of an optimistic, hardworking period. Its overall regularity references a time when the machine was king—the late days of the Industrial Age. Imagine vintage instructions on signs or paper; they may be created by machinery or by hand, yet both have that industrial sensibility. We sense visions in the 1950s—and earlier—of what the Nuclear Age would look like. Voltage calls to mind gas stations, machinists, receipts at machine shops, trips to the soda fountain at the drugstore, shopping at the five and dime. Yet, in its twists and small irregularities, we see vestiges of hand-painted signage, the rivets in beloved, old, worn blue jeans, the touch of the ”common man” who, alongside women, built America

Woolen by Magpie Paper Works.
Woolen is a font inspired by freshly fallen snow and swags of mistletoe. Her italicized letters are based upon a type specimen by Jean Jannon, originally published by the Imprimerie Royale in 1641. Many of the capital letters are decorated with small sprouts of mistletoe, though they can also be spring leaves, depending on how you use the font! This font is a subtle and organic update to a classic serif typeface - she is warm and historical without being too trendy.

Apple, Trapper Keeper, and Reebok: Three of the most well-known brands of the 1980s, and three companies that used the same futuristic-looking typeface to do it. So why isn't the typeface a classic like other period pieces *cough*Helvetica*cough*? Fate is a funny thing.
